Portrait of Henry IV and Marie de' Medici

1603 (Early Modern) 2 5/8 in. (6.7 cm) (w.) Citation Source image

King Henry IV of France (1553-1609) and his wife Marie de' Medici (1573-1642) are portrayed in profile on this medal, in imitation of ancient Roman coins, which featured the profile of the emperors. Depicting Henry in armor reminded the viewer of the military might of the thro...

provenance
provenance
Frédéric Spitzer, Paris, by purchase; Sale, Paul Chevallier and Charles Mannheim, April 17, 1893, no. 16; Henry Walters, New York [date of acquisition unknown], by purchase; Sadie Jones (Mrs. Henry Walters), New York, 1931, by inheritance; Sale, Parke-Bernet, New York, May 2, 1941, no. 1271; Douglas Huntly Gordon, Baltimore, 1941, by purchase; Walters Art Museum, 1941, by gift.
